WebTriple Redundancy was a robot that competed in the Featherweight category at the 1996 US Robot Wars championship. Triple Redundancy fought in the Featherweight melee in the 1996 Championship which was featured in the American Robot Wars 1996 VHS. Triple Redundancy was a clusterbot made up of three RC cars of different sizes. WebJul 27, 2013 · The features of the internal motion caused by kinematic redundancy are considered, and a kinematic model and a dynamic model of the snake robot are derived by introducing two types of shape controllable point. The first is the head shape controllable point, and the other is the base shape controllable point.
